What is the difference between a sled and a sleigh?

Both have runners, but a sled is smaller and typically used by children to slide down slopes. A sleigh is larger and typically pulled by horses.

Sleigh refers to a moderate to large-sized, usually open-topped vehicle to carry passengers or goods, and typically drawn by horses, dogs, or reindeer. In American usage sled remains the general term but often implies a smaller device, often for recreational use.
